Transaction fc611b5a3064dde8195292bee0b576fe5200af1fe70ac06c69e5000db57dcaae
1 Input
1 Output
-
fc611b5a3064dde8195292bee0b576fe5200af1fe70ac06c69e5000db57dcaae:0
- value
- 1034957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ca55ec76ed33e7cbf8a8d9d45b92b59da84d9e51 OP_EQUAL
- address
- 3L8sMNmX9Q4hiiWuwbk5VWDRgRC3rxXBX4